Stop

/stɒp/

Meaning & Definition

noun
A cessation of movement or operation.
There was a sudden stop in traffic due to the accident.
A place where a vehicle stops to pick up or drop off passengers.
The bus stop is just around the corner.
A device that prevents something from moving or functioning.
Make sure to use the emergency stop in case of a malfunction.
verb
To cause to come to a halt; to bring to a standstill.
Please stop talking so we can hear the presentation.
To cease or discontinue an action or process.
She decided to stop jogging for a while due to her injury.
To block or impede something.
The police are trying to stop the spread of misinformation.

Etymology

Old English stoppian, from Proto-Germanic *stuppōną to close, obstruct.

Common Phrases and Expressions

stop at nothing:
To do whatever is necessary to achieve something.
stop short:
To suddenly cease moving or to halt abruptly.
stop and smell the roses:
To take time to appreciate the moments in life.
